Genres: Comedy, Drama
Director: Julian Branciforte
Writer: Julian Branciforte
Stars: John Magaro, Christopher McDonald, Dreama Walker

Film Story: Battling picture taker Robert (John Magaro) and his philandering father Harry (Christopher McDonald) understand that they both had a one-night stand with the same lady, Sara-Beth, around the same time. A long time later, they understand that both of them may be the natural father of her delightful four-year-old little girl. The two begrudgingly consent to share
protective obligations until the consequences of a paternity test return, constraining the two to at long last invest some energy with each other. 

Film Review: The essential center in the light comic drama show "Don't Worry Baby" — the promising component presentation of the author chief Julian Branciforte — might be its millennial performing artists, however it's the more seasoned players who bring the weight. Robert (John Magaro) is a hangdog Manhattan picture taker thrashing after introductory achievement; now he perseveres through the outrage of working for his philandering father, Harry (Christopher McDonald), who runs an Upper East Side preschool.


At the point when a young lady, Mason (Rainn Williams), is enlisted there, Robert and Harry find that they both know her mom, Sara Beth (a wide-peered toward Dreama Walker), a sprouting style creator back in New York after a broadened rest in Tennessee. Father and child each had a sexual experience with her around the same time years prior, and the personality of Mason's dad is questionable. While they anticipate paternity-test results, Robert, Harry and Sarah Beth — and Harry's repelled spouse, Miriam (Talia Balsam) — have much to discuss. 

Britt Lower, as a yearning performing artist looking at Robert, is a floating sentimental nearness, while Tom Lipinski, as Robert's ne'er-do-well flat mate, a lender with a ravenousness for pot and porn movies, loans cleverness. The youthful Ms. Williams, luckily, is not abused for her lovableness; rather, her character is introduced as a parkway to development. Ms. Walker's part, however, is fairly a figure. 

In spite of an unrealistic completion without outcome, "Don't Worry Baby" profits by clean altering, cinematography and, the majority of all, the nearness of the prepared Mr. McDonald and Ms. Resin. Their nuanced power — and the energetic Manhattan setting — make the trek advantageous.
